a. Illuminate Your Kitchen with Glass Tile Backsplash Reflective Qualities for a Brighter Kitchen

One of the most appealing aspects of a glass tile backsplash is its reflective nature. Glass tiles naturally bounce light around the room, making your kitchen appear brighter and more spacious. This quality is particularly beneficial in smaller kitchens or those with limited natural light, as it can help to create a more open and airy atmosphere.

In addition to enhancing the overall brightness of the space, a glass tile backsplash can also highlight other design elements in your kitchen, such as countertops, cabinetry, and appliances. The tiles’ reflective surface captures and amplifies light, drawing attention to the finer details of your kitchen design.

c. Illuminate Your Kitchen with Glass Tile Backsplash Easy Maintenance and Durability

In addition to their aesthetic appeal, glass tile backsplashes are known for their durability and ease of maintenance. Glass is a non-porous material, meaning it doesn’t absorb moisture, stains, or odors, making it resistant to mold and mildew. This makes glass tiles an excellent choice for areas prone to splashes and spills, such as behind the stove or sink.

Cleaning a glass tile backsplash is a breeze—simply wipe it down with a damp cloth and a mild cleaner to keep it looking as good as new. The durability of glass tiles also ensures that your backsplash will remain pristine and beautiful for years to come, even in the busiest of kitchens.

d. Illuminate Your Kitchen with Glass Tile Backsplash Back-Painted Glass Tiles

Back-painted glass tiles are a modern option that offers a sleek and seamless look. These tiles are made by painting the back of clear glass, creating a smooth, glossy surface with a rich, even color. The result is a highly reflective backsplash that adds depth and vibrancy to your kitchen.

Back-painted glass tiles are available in virtually any color, making them an excellent choice for those who want a custom look. Whether you prefer a bold, statement-making color or a soft, neutral shade, back-painted glass tiles can be tailored to match your kitchen’s color scheme perfectly.

c. Illuminate Your Kitchen with Glass Tile Backsplash Think About Color and Light

The color of your glass tile backsplash can significantly impact the overall mood and ambiance of your kitchen. Light-colored glass tiles, such as white, cream, or pastel shades, can create a bright and airy feel, making the kitchen appear larger and more open. These colors are especially effective in small or dimly lit kitchens.

Darker glass tiles, such as navy, charcoal, or emerald, can add drama and sophistication to the kitchen. However, they work best in larger spaces or kitchens with ample natural light, as they can make a small or poorly lit kitchen feel more enclosed.

In addition to color, consider how the tiles will interact with the lighting in your kitchen. Under-cabinet lighting can enhance the reflective qualities of glass tiles, creating a luminous effect that highlights the backsplash’s beauty. If possible, bring tile samples into your kitchen and observe how they look under different lighting conditions before making a final decision.

1. Illuminate Your Kitchen with Glass Tile Backsplash Vidrepur

Vidrepur is renowned for its handcrafted Spanish mosaic glass tiles made from 100% recycled glass. This brand focuses on producing environmentally responsible products that are both visually appealing and practical. Their mosaics are suitable for a variety of applications, including backsplashes, countertops, and swimming pools.
